Equipment Overview

The MK 4020F Fiber Laser Cutting Machine is a fully enclosed large-format fiber laser cutting system designed for high-speed, high-precision metal sheet fabrication in high-volume production environments. Its core engineering philosophy centers on overwhelming throughput—achieved through rapid axis acceleration, ultra-fast worktable exchange, and a heavy-duty stress-relieved frame that maintains stable performance under continuous operation, making it ideal for sheet metal workshops pursuing scalable mass production efficiency.

In practical terms, the MK 4020F delivers exceptional efficiency for batch processing of medium to large sheet metal components across industries such as automotive, construction machinery, electrical enclosures, hardware fixtures, and aerospace. A real-world application example: a commercial sheet metal manufacturer deployed the MK 4020F to produce 2mm carbon steel cabinet panels, achieving a 12m/min thin-sheet cutting speed with a 15-second table exchange cycle, reducing overall part production lead time by 40% compared to conventional single-table laser cutting equipment.

At its core, the MK 4020F combines rigid cast iron construction, an advanced industrial CNC control system, and high-dynamic linear drive transmission with up to 2.0G axis acceleration. This combination translates directly into shorter production cycles, consistent burr-free cutting quality, and the versatility to handle a full spectrum of metal materials, from thin aluminum alloy and galvanized sheet to thick carbon steel and stainless steel.


Technical Specifications


General Processing Specifications

Model MK 4020F

Machine type Fully enclosed dual-exchange-table fiber laser cutting machine

Effective Cutting Area 4000 mm × 2000 mm

Worktable Motor-driven dual exchange pallet table

Table Exchange Time ≤ 15 s

Max Workpiece Weight Per Table 900 kg


Laser System

Laser Type Solid-state fiber laser, wavelength 1070 nm

Configurable Laser Power 1000W / 1500W / 2000W / 3000W / 4000W / 6000W (higher power optional)

Laser source options Raycus / Max (domestic premium) / IPG (imported)

Rated Service Life of Laser Source ≥ 100,000 hours

Cooling Method Industrial closed-loop water chiller


Motion & Positioning Accuracy

X/Y Axis Max Positioning Speed 140 m/min

X/Y Axis Max Acceleration 1.5–2.5 G (varies by configuration)

Positioning Accuracy ±0.03 mm/m

Repositioning Accuracy ±0.02 mm

Minimum Command Unit 0.001 mm

Transmission Structure Gantry dual-drive, helical rack & pinion + linear guide rail


Core Mechanical & Optical Components

Cutting Head Raytools auto-focus laser cutting head, IP65 dust-proof rating

Servo System Yaskawa AC servo motor & driver

Linear Guide Taiwan HIWIN precision linear guide rail

Rack Taiwan YYC precision helical rack

Machine Bed Integral stress-relieved welded steel bed

Enclosure Full closed protective cover with safety interlock


Control System & Software

CNC Control System CypCut professional laser cutting control system

Supported File Formats DXF, PLT, DWG, AI, BMP, G-code

Functions Auto nesting, edge detection, perforation control, real-time power adjustment


Electrical & Environmental Requirements

Power Supply 380V / 50Hz / 60Hz, 3-phase

Total Power Consumption 18–52 kW (corresponding to 1000W–6000W laser power)

Operating Ambient Temperature 5–40 ℃

Relative Humidity ≤ 90% (non-condensing)


Overall Dimensions & Weight

Overall Footprint (L×W×H) approx. 9000 × 5000 × 2200 mm

Net Machine Weight approx. 11,000 kg



Key Features & Advantages

1. High-Throughput Design for High-Volume Production

Dual exchange worktable with ≤15s rapid switching enables simultaneous loading/unloading and cutting, eliminating idle time and boosting overall production efficiency by over 30% compared to single-table models.

Gantry dual-drive structure delivers up to 140 m/min maximum traverse speed and 2.0G axis acceleration, ensuring fast piercing and cutting for batch sheet metal processing.

2. Stable High-Precision Cutting Performance

±0.03 mm/m positioning accuracy and ±0.02 mm repositioning accuracy guarantee consistent dimensional precision for complex contour parts.

Auto-focus Raytools cutting head with IP65 protection automatically adjusts focal length for different materials and thicknesses, delivering burr-free, smooth cut surfaces with minimal secondary finishing.

Integral stress-relieved welded steel bed with excellent rigidity suppresses vibration during high-speed operation, maintaining long-term accuracy stability under 24/7 continuous production.

3. Premium Core Components for Extended Reliability

Configurable industry-leading fiber laser sources (Raycus / Max / IPG) with a rated service life of ≥100,000 hours, featuring low energy consumption and almost no maintenance costs for the optical path.

Equipped with Taiwan HIWIN linear guide rails, YYC helical racks and Yaskawa AC servo system, ensuring smooth transmission, low wear and reliable long-term operation.

Fully enclosed protective cover with safety interlock prevents laser radiation and dust spillage, creating a safe working environment and extending the service life of internal components.

4. Smart CNC System for Low-Threshold Operation

Professional CypCut CNC control system supports multiple file formats including DXF, DWG, PLT and AI, with built-in automatic nesting, edge detection and perforation control functions, reducing programming effort and material waste.

Real-time power adjustment and fault self-diagnosis simplify daily operation and maintenance, lowering the skill requirement for frontline operators.

5. Wide Versatility Across Materials & Industries

Capable of processing a full range of metal materials such as carbon steel, stainless steel, aluminum alloy, galvanized sheet and brass, covering thickness from 0.5mm thin sheets to 25mm thick plates.

Ideal for batch manufacturing in automotive components, construction machinery, electrical cabinets, hardware fixtures and aerospace sectors, serving as a flexible alternative to traditional stamping and plasma cutting processes.
